版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
1、第2节 程序基本知识第11章 程序设计一、学习目标1、了解程序的基本构成。2、掌握变量、函数、表达式等概念。3、理解顺序结构程序的执行过程及简单代码的编写。二、复习回顾见书见书p81p81,用,用vbvb编写一个如图所示编写一个如图所示“求圆面积求圆面积”的程序。的程序。vb中对象三要素vbvb中的对象有各自的中的对象有各自的属性属性、事件事件和和方法方法,它们构成了对象的三要素。,它们构成了对象的三要素。(1 1)属性)属性(2 2)事件)事件(3 3)方法)方法属性决定了对象的具体特征。如大小、位置、颜色等。 事件指对象的某个动作。如单击、双击、移动鼠标等。一个对象可以响应多种事件。 封装
2、在对象内部的现成的、可以直接调用的程序。各种对象中包含有不同的方法。如print(打印)、circle(画圆)、line(画线)cls(清除屏幕内容)等。显示桌面.scf三、探究学习 参考书参考书p85-86p85-86,编写一个,编写一个“涂鸦涂鸦”程序:程序:运行程序后,按住左键移动鼠标即可在窗体运行程序后,按住左键移动鼠标即可在窗体上即兴作画,双击窗体将所画的内容清除。上即兴作画,双击窗体将所画的内容清除。四、vb常用语句一个程序是由若干条一个程序是由若干条语句语句组成。一般一条语句一行。组成。一般一条语句一行。(1 1)赋值语句)赋值语句(2 2)注释语句)注释语句(3 3)结束语句)
3、结束语句语句格式:let let 变量变量= =表达式表达式其中“=”是赋值号,它的作用是将赋值号右边表达式的值赋给左边的变量。赋值语句中let有时可以省略。语句格式:rem rem 注释内容注释内容 注释语句的作用是给程序注解,以增加可读性。注释语句在程序中为非执行语句,当然也可以省略。语句格式:endendend语句的作用是结束程序。五、vb函数函数的一般格式为:函数名(参数函数名(参数1 1,参数,参数22)说明:函数一般出现在表达式中,它总要返回一个函数值。在vb中提供了大量的内部函数(也称标准函数):函数函数函数值函数值函数值类型函数值类型abs(x)x的绝对值数值int(x)取不大
4、于x的最大整数数值sqr(x)x的平方根值数值rnd(x)产生0,1的随机数数值val(x)将字符型数据转化成数值型数据数值str(x)将数值型数据转化成字符型数据字符inputbox产生一个对话框,等待从键盘输入信息字符提示:提示:inputboxinputbox(提示文字,(提示文字, ,对话框标题,对话框标题,输入的缺省值,输入的缺省值 )六、输入信息(1 1)常量和数据类型)常量和数据类型(2 2)变量)变量(3 3)利用文本控件的文本属性输入信息)利用文本控件的文本属性输入信息常量,就是其值保持不变的量。例如:=3.1416常量的类型主要有:整型integer,字符串型string,
5、 逻辑型boolean等变量,就是其值可以变化的量。例如:let m=3中的m就是变量变量的类型也有整型、实数型、字符型、逻辑型等。例1:text3.text=text1.text+text2.text (其含义为两个文本框内容的连接”12”+”34”=“1234”) 例2:text3.text=val(text1.text)+val(text2.text) (其含义为两个文本框内容的相加”12”+”34”=“46”)七、处理信息(1 1)算术运算符与算术表达式)算术运算符与算术表达式(2 2)字符运算符与字符串表达式)字符运算符与字符串表达式算术运算符算术运算符功能功能算术运算符算术运算符功
6、能功能+正号或加法运算/除法运算-负号或减法运算乘方运算*乘法运算字符运算符字符运算符功能功能+将两个字符表达式连接成1个新字符串&将两个不管是字符型还是数值型表达式连接成1个新字符串八、输出信息(1 1)利用文本框或标签输出信息)利用文本框或标签输出信息(2 2)利用)利用printprint方法在窗体中输出信息方法在窗体中输出信息 利用赋值语句向文本框对象的text属性或标签对象的caption属性进行赋值输出信息。例如:let text1.text=3.14 let label1.caption=“vb程序设计”print是vb窗体的内置方法,可以直接使用。格式:格式:print print 表达式表达式1 1;表达式;表达式2 2;注意:1、表达式之间也可以用逗号隔开 2、末尾有符号则不换行,末尾没符号则换行九、课堂实践一1、编写“孙悟空上织女星”程序 步骤一:建立由图像和两个命令按钮组成的程序界面(书p89)。 步骤二:设置对象属性。 步骤三:在2个命令按钮代码窗口输入相应的程序(书p87-88)。 步骤四:运行于调试程序。 步骤五
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 《吉加·维尔托夫》课件
- 2025年中考英语一轮教材复习 九年级(上) Unit 3-1
- 旅游概论(上海旅游高等专科学校)知到智慧树答案
- 课件:《躺在波浪上看书》
- 居民服务公司养老产业项目可行性研究报告
- 《围绝经期综合征》课件
- 杜甫《登高》精美公开课-课件
- 《临床危急值解析》课件
- (部编版八年级《政治》下册课件)第1课时-公民权利的保障书
- 《术前讨论制度》课件
- 公路养护资质标准汇编整理
- HSF有害物质管理控制程序
- AFC1500拧紧控制器
- 风险分级管控责任清单
- 八年级上册历史知识结构图
- 特殊建设工程消防设计审查申请表
- 科普知识讲座(火箭)PPT精选课件
- 莫尔条纹干涉光学系统仿真设计
- 未婚承诺书模板
- 建筑施工组织课程设计某校区办公楼单位工程施工组织设计
- 相亲相爱一家人简谱歌词
评论
0/150
提交评论